奥鹏答案 发表于 2016-11-23 16:52:19

16秋北航《数据库原理及应用》在线作业答案

16秋北航《数据库原理及应用》在线作业一

一、单选题:
1.数据库系统的核心是(    )。          (满分:4)
    A. 数据模型
    B. 数据库管理系统
    C. 软件工具
    D. 数据库
2.Visual FoxPro数据库文件是(    )。          (满分:4)
    A. 存放用户数据的文件
    B. 管理数据库对象的系统文件
    C. 存放用户数据和系统的文件
    D. 前三种说法都对
3.DB的转储属于DBS的(    )          (满分:4)
    A. 完整性措施
    B. 安全行措施
    C. 并发控制措施
    D. 恢复措施
4.数据库系统软件包括DBMS和          (满分:4)
    A. 数据库
    B. 高级语言
    C. OS
    D. 数据库应用系统和开发工具
5.数据的逻辑独立性是指(    )。          (满分:4)
    A. 概念模式改变,外模式和应用程序不变
    B. 概念模式改变,内模式不变
    C. 内模式改变,概念模式不变
    D. 内模式改变,外模式和应用程序不变
6.在SQL语言中,用户可以直接操作的是(    )          (满分:4)
    A. 基本表
    B. 视图
    C. 基本表和视图
    D. 基本表或视图
7.在关系数据库管理系统中,创建的视图在数据库三层结构中属于(    )。          (满分:4)
    A. 外模式
    B. 存储模式
    C. 内模式
    D. 概念模式
8.在DB的概念设计和逻辑设计之间起桥梁作用的是(    )          (满分:4)
    A. 数据结构图
    B. 功能模块图
    C. ER图
    D. DFD
9.数据库DB、数据库系统DBS、数据库管理系统DBMS三者之间的关系是(    )。          (满分:4)
    A. DBS包括DB和DBMS
    B. DBMS包括DB和DBS
    C. DB包括DBS和DBMS
    D. DBS就是DB,也就是DBMS
10.关系数据模型的基本数据结构是(    )。          (满分:4)
    A. 树
    B. 图
    C. 索引
    D. 关系
11.DBAS指的是(    )。          (满分:4)
    A. 数据库管理系统
    B. 数据库系统
    C. 数据库应用系统
    D. 数据库服务系统
12.模式的逻辑子集通常称为(    )          (满分:4)
    A. 存储模式
    B. 内模式
    C. 外模式
    D. 模式
13.模型是对现实世界的抽象,在数据库技术中,用模型的概念描述数据库的结构与语义,对现实世界进行抽象。表示实体类型及实体间联系的模型称为(    ).          (满分:4)
    A. 数据模型
    B. 实体模型
    C. 逻辑模型
    D. 物理模型
14.在ER图中,用长方形表示,用椭圆表示(    )          (满分:4)
    A. 联系、属性
    B. 属性、实体
    C. 实体、属性
    D. 什么也不代表、实体
15.四元关系R的属性A、B、C、D,下列叙述中正确的是(    )          (满分:4)
    A. ∏B
    C(R)表示取值为B,C的两列组成的关系
    B. ∏2
    3(R)表示取值为2,3的两列组成的关系
    C. ∏B
    C(R)与∏2
    3(R)表示的是同一个关系
    D. ∏B
    C(R)与∏2
    3(R)表示的不是同一个关系
16.下面关于数据环境和数据环境中两个表之间的关系的陈述中,(    )是正确的。          (满分:4)
    A. 数据环境是对象,关系不是对象
    B. 数据环境不是对象,关系是对象
    C. 数据环境是对象,关系是数据环境中的对象
    D. 数据环境和关系均不是对象
17.SQL的ROLLBACK语句的主要作用是(    )          (满分:4)
    A. 终止程序
    B. 中断程序
    C. 事务提交
    D. 事务回退
18.下面叙述正确的是(    )。          (满分:4)
    A. 算法的执行效率与数据的存储结构无关
    B. 算法的空间复杂度是指算法程序中指令(或语句)的条数
    C. 算法的有穷性是指算法必须能在执行有限个步骤之后终止
    D. 以上三种描述都不对
19.CODASYL组织提出的DBTG报告中的数据模型是(    )的主要代表          (满分:4)
    A. 层次模型
    B. 网状模型
    C. 关系模型
    D. 实体联系模型
20.SQL语言中,条件“年龄BETWEEN 20 AND 30”表示年龄在20至30之间,且(    )          (满分:4)
    A. 包括20岁和30岁
    B. 不包括20岁和30岁
    C. 包括20岁但不包括30岁
    D. 包括30岁但不包括20岁
21.关系R与关系S只有一个公共属性,T1是R与S等值联接的结果,T2是R与S等值自然联接的结果,则(    )          (满分:4)
    A. T1的属性个数等于T2的属性个数
    B. T1的属性个数小于T2的属性个数
    C. T1的属性个数大于T2的属性个数
    D. T1的属性个数大于或等于T2的属性个数
22.下列命题中不正确的是(    )。          (满分:4)
    A. 数据库减少了不必要的数据冗余
    B. 数据库中不存在冗余数据
    C. 数据库中的数据可以共享
    D. 若冗余数据是可控的,则数据更新的一致性得以保证
23.已知关系R和S,R∩S等价于(    )。          (满分:4)
    A.(R﹣S)﹣S
    B. S﹣(S﹣R)
    C.(S﹣R)﹣R
    D. S﹣(R﹣S)
24.“运行记录优先原则”只指应该在对数据库更新(    )          (满分:4)
    A. 前先写一个日志记录到日志文件
    B. 后写一个日志记录到日志文件
    C. 前先运行记录
    D. 后在日志缓冲区运行记录
25.在数据库三级模式间引入二级映象的主要作用是(    )          (满分:4)
    A. 提高数据与程序的独立性
    B. 提高数据与程序的安全性
    C. 保持数据与程序的一致性
    D. 提高数据与程序的可移植性
北航《数据库原理及应用》在线作业二

一、单选题:
1.ER图是表示概念模型的有效工具之一,在ER图中的菱形框表示(    )          (满分:4)
    A. 联系
    B. 实体
    C. 实体的属性
    D. 联系的属性
2.单个用户使用的数据视图的描述称为(    )          (满分:4)
    A. 外模式
    B. 概念模式
    C. 内模式
    D. 存储模式
3.设有关系R1和R2,经过关系运算得到结果S,则S是(    )。          (满分:4)
    A. 一个关系
    B. 一个表单
    C. 一个数据库
    D. 一个数组
4.SQL Server2000的物理存储主要包括3类文件(    )          (满分:4)
    A. 主数据文件、次数据文件、事务日志文件
    B. 主数据文件、次数据文件、文本文件
    C. 表文件、索引文件、存储过程
    D. 表文件、索引文件、图表文件
5.用户涉及的逻辑结构用(    )描述          (满分:4)
    A. 模式
    B. 存储模式
    C. 概念模式
    D. 子模式
6.对数据库的物理设计优劣评价的重点是(    )          (满分:4)
    A. 时间和空间效率
    B. 动态和静态性能
    C. 用户界面的友好性
    D. 成本和效益
7.在关系数据库管理系统中,创建的视图在数据库三层结构中属于(    )。          (满分:4)
    A. 外模式
    B. 存储模式
    C. 内模式
    D. 概念模式
8.当关系R(A,B)已属于3NF,下列说法中(    )是正确的。          (满分:4)
    A. 它一定消除了插入和删除异常
    B. 仍存在一定的插入和删除异常
    C. 一定属于BCNF
    D. A和C都是
9.事务的原子性是指(    )          (满分:4)
    A. 事务中包括的所有操作要么多做,要么都不做
    B. 事务一旦提交,对数据库的改变就是永久的
    C. 一个事务内部的操作及使用的数据对并发的其他事务是隔离的
    D. 事务必须是使数据库从一个一致性状态变到另一个一致性状态
10.关于关系,下面说法正确的是(    )          (满分:4)
    A. 关系是笛卡尔积的任意子集
    B. 不同属性不能出自同一个域
    C. 实体可用关系来表示,而实体之间的联系不能用关系来表示
    D. 关系的每一个分量必须是不可分的数据项
11.在关系模式R(U,F)中,如果X→U,则X是R的(    )          (满分:4)
    A. 侯选键
    B. 超键
    C. 主键
    D. 外键
12.下列关于关系数据库语言SQL语言的说法不正确的是(    )          (满分:4)
    A. SQL支持数据库的三级模式结构
    B. SQL的功能包括查询、操作、定义和控制等四个方面
    C. SQL是作为独立语言由联机终端用户在交互环境下使用的命令语言,它不能嵌入高级语言内
    D. SQL除应用在数据库领域外,还在软件工程、人工智能领域有广泛的应用
13.数据库系统不仅包括数据库本身,还要包括相应的硬件,软件和          (满分:4)
    A. 数据库管理系统
    B. 数据库应用系统
    C. 相关的计算机系统
    D. 各类相关人员
14.下列有关数据库的恢复的说法中不正确的是(    )          (满分:4)
    A. 应定期将数据库做成档案文件
    B. 在进行事务处理过程时数据库更新的全部内容写入日志文件
    C. 发生故障时用当时数据内容和档案文件更新前的映象,将文件恢复到最近的检查点文件状态。
    D. 数据库恢复,还可用最新的档案文件和日志文件的更新映象,将文件恢复到最新的检查点文件状态。
15.下面关于数据环境和数据环境中两个表之间的关系的陈述中,(    )是正确的。          (满分:4)
    A. 数据环境是对象,关系不是对象
    B. 数据环境不是对象,关系是对象
    C. 数据环境是对象,关系是数据环境中的对象
    D. 数据环境和关系均不是对象
16.下列四项中,不属于数据库特点的是(    )。          (满分:4)
    A. 数据共享
    B. 数据完整性
    C. 数据冗余很高
    D. 数据独立性高
17.SQL的DDL语句不包括(    )          (满分:4)
    A. SELECT
    B. CREATE TABLE
    C. DROP VIEW
    D. DROP INDEX
18.当关系R和S自然联接时,能够把R和S原该舍弃的元组放到结果关系中的操作是(    )          (满分:4)
    A. 左外联接
    B. 右外联接
    C. 外部并
    D. 外联接
19.在SELECT语句中使用GROUP BY SNO时,SNO必须(    )          (满分:4)
    A. 在WHERE中出现
    B. 在FROM中出现
    C. 在SELECT中出现
    D. 在HAVING中出现
20.已经被确定为RDBMS的国际标准的语言是(    )。          (满分:4)
    A. JDBC
    B. HTML
    C. ASP
    D. SQL
21.已知学生关系:R(学号,姓名,系名称,系地址),每一名学生属于一个系,每一个系有一个地址,则R属于(    )。          (满分:4)
    A. 1NF
    B. 2NF
    C. 3NF
    D. 4NF
22.在标准SQL中,建立视图的命令是(    )。          (满分:4)
    A. CREATE SCHEMA命令
    B. CREATE TABLE命令
    C. CREATE VIEW命令
    D. CREATE INDEX命令
23.在SELECT语句中,对应关系代数中“投影”运算的语句是(    )          (满分:4)
    A. SELECT
    B. FROM
    C. WHERE
    D. SET
24.下面关于关系性质的说法,错误的是 (    )。          (满分:4)
    A. 表中的一行称为一个元组
    B. 行与列交叉点不允许有多个值
    C. 表中的一列称为一个属性
    D. 表中任意两行可能相同
25.ER图是数据库设计的工具之一,它适用于建立数据库的(    )。          (满分:4)
    A. 需求模型
    B. 概念模型
    C. 逻辑模型
    D. 物理模型
北航《数据库原理及应用》在线作业三

一、单选题:
1.实体集书店与图书之间具有(    )联系。          (满分:4)
    A. 一对一
    B. 一对多
    C. 多对多
    D. 多对一
2.DBMS中实现事务持久性的子系统是 (    )          (满分:4)
    A. 安全性管理子系统
    B. 完整性管理子系统
    C. 并发控制子系统
    D. 恢复管理子系统
3.关系数据库的查询语言是一种(    )语言。          (满分:4)
    A. 过程性
    B. 非过程性
    C. 第三代
    D. 高级程序设计
4.子模式是(    )。          (满分:4)
    A. 模式的副本;;;
    B. 模式的逻辑子集
    C. 多个模式的集合
    D. 以上的答案全部正确
5.下面列出的数据库管理技术发展的3个阶段中,没有专门的软件对数据进行管理的是(    ).Ⅰ. 人工管理阶段   Ⅱ.文件系统阶段   Ⅲ.数据库阶段          (满分:4)
    A. Ⅰ和Ⅱ
    B. 只有Ⅱ
    C. Ⅱ和Ⅲ
    D. 只有Ⅰ
6.SQL语言是(    )语言          (满分:4)
    A. 层次数据库
    B. 网络数据库
    C. 关系数据库
    D. 非数据库
7.如何构造出一个合适的数据逻辑结构是(    )主要解决的问题。          (满分:4)
    A. 关系数据库优化
    B. 数据字典
    C. 关系数据库规范化理论
    D. 关系数据库查询
8.(    )是控制数据整体结构的人,负责三级结构定义和修改          (满分:4)
    A. 专业用户
    B. 应用程序员
    C. DBA
    D. 一般用户
9.关于关系,下面说法正确的是(    )          (满分:4)
    A. 关系是笛卡尔积的任意子集
    B. 不同属性不能出自同一个域
    C. 实体可用关系来表示,而实体之间的联系不能用关系来表示
    D. 关系的每一个分量必须是不可分的数据项
10.描述数据库中全体数据的逻辑结构和特征是(    )          (满分:4)
    A. 内模式
    B. 模式
    C. 外模式
    D. 存储模式
11.一个关系只有一个(    )。          (满分:4)
    A. 候选码
    B. 外码
    C. 超码
    D. 主码
12.已经被确定为RDBMS的国际标准的语言是(    )。          (满分:4)
    A. JDBC
    B. HTML
    C. ASP
    D. SQL
13.在关系模式R(姓名,年龄,职位,出生日)中最有可能做主关键字的是(    )          (满分:4)
    A. 姓名
    B. 年龄
    C. 职位
    D. 出生日
14.下列有关数据库的描述,正确的是(    )。          (满分:4)
    A. 数据库是一个DBF文件
    B. 数据库是一个关系
    C. 数据库是一个结构化的数据集合
    D. 数据库是一组文件
15.在标准SQL中,建立视图的命令是(    )。          (满分:4)
    A. CREATE SCHEMA命令
    B. CREATE TABLE命令
    C. CREATE VIEW命令
    D. CREATE INDEX命令
16.视图是一个“虚表”,视图的构造基于(    )          (满分:4)
    A. 基本表
    B. 视图
    C. 基本表或视图
    D. 数据字典
17.若关系R(A,B)已属于3NF,下列说法中正确的是          (满分:4)
    A. 它一定消除了插入和删除异常
    B. 仍存在一定的插入和删除异常
    C. 一定属于BCNF
    D. A和C都是
18.四元关系R的属性A、B、C、D,下列叙述中正确的是(    )          (满分:4)
    A. ∏B
    C(R)表示取值为B,C的两列组成的关系
    B. ∏2
    3(R)表示取值为2,3的两列组成的关系
    C. ∏B
    C(R)与∏2
    3(R)表示的是同一个关系
    D. ∏B
    C(R)与∏2
    3(R)表示的不是同一个关系
19.若用如下的SQL语句创建了一个表S :CREATE TABLE S(S# CHAR(6) NOT NULL, SNAME CHAR(8) NOT NULL, SEX CHAR(2), AGE INTEGER) 今向S表插入如下行时,哪一行可以被插入          (满分:4)
    A.('991001'
    '李明芳'
    女,'23')
    B.('990746'
    '张为'
    NULL
    NULL)
    C.(NULL
    '陈道一','男'
    32)
    D.('992345'
    NULL
    '女'
    25)
20.五种基本关系代数运算是(    )          (满分:4)
    A. ∪,-,×,π和σ
    B. ∪,-,∞,π和σ
    C. ∪,∩,×,π和σ
    D. ∪,∩,∞,π和σ
21.下列聚合函数中不忽略空值(null) 的是(    )          (满分:4)
    A. SUM(列名)
    B. MAX(列名)
    C. COUNT( * )
    D. AVG(列名)
22.ER图是表示概念模型的有效工具之一,在ER图中的菱形框表示(    )          (满分:4)
    A. 联系
    B. 实体
    C. 实体的属性
    D. 联系的属性
23.索引字段值不唯一,应该选择的索引类型为(    )。          (满分:4)
    A. 主索引
    B. 普通索引
    C. 候选索引
    D. 唯一索引
24.根据关系数据库规范化理论,关系数据库中的关系要满足第一范式,下面“部门”关系中,因哪个属性而使它不满足第一范式(    ) 部门(部门号,部门名,部门成员,部门总经理)          (满分:4)
    A. 部门总经理
    B. 部门成员
    C. 部门名
    D. 部门号
25.数据库(DB)、数据库系统(DBS)及数据库管理系统(DBMS)三者之间的关系是(    )          (满分:4)
    A. DBS包含DB和DBMS
    B. DBMS包含DB和DBS
    C. DB包含DBS和DBMS
    D. DBS包含DB,也就是DBMS

**** Hidden Message *****
页: [1]
查看完整版本: 16秋北航《数据库原理及应用》在线作业答案